woodcock
Esteemed Legend

Like this:

index=YourIndexHere sourcetype=YourSourcetypeHere Port 2003 farm total
| rex "Port 2003 farm total\s*=\s*(?<port2003farmtotal>\d+)"
| search port2003farmtotal<21

maybe something like this if you don't have that field extracted yet, otherwise if you do, you should just need the search:

rex "Port 2003 farm total = (?<port2003farmtotal>\d+)"|search port2003farmtotal<21
